§74-3008. Exceptions - Competitive bid requirement not applicable – Annual pricing review.

Universal Citation: 74 OK Stat § 3008 (2022)

A. Nothing in Section 3001 et seq. of this title pursuant to purchases of products and services from people with significant disabilities shall be construed to prohibit any department or agency of the state from manufacturing or supplying its own products or services for its own use. Procurements made pursuant to Section 3001 et seq. of this title shall not be subject to the competitive bid requirements of the Oklahoma Central Purchasing Act, Section 85.1 et seq. of this title.

B. The Office of Management and Enterprise Services Central Purchasing Division shall require an annual qualified organization pricing review for all products and services approved and designated on the procurement schedule. The method of the pricing review shall be defined in the promulgated rules.

C. When the fair market price for a product or service approved by the Office of Management and Enterprise Services Central Purchasing Division exceeds a current market price for the same product or service and such lower market price has been verified by the agency through compliance with the fair market analysis process approved by the Office of Management and Enterprise Services Central Purchasing Division, the State Use contracting officer may grant a temporary exception to a requesting agency so that the agency may purchase the product or service from the supplier offering the lower market price.

Added by Laws 1973, c. 20, § 8, operative July 1, 1973. Amended by Laws 1984, c. 159, § 2, eff. Nov. 1, 1984; Laws 1996, c. 322, § 8, emerg. eff. June 12, 1996; Laws 2022, c. 252, § 10, eff. Nov. 1, 2022.
